description |
Fig. 6. Effect of UV-B radiation on DaCHS gene. Control plants were maintained in a growth chamber with a PAR regime (16/8 h). Treated plants underwent the same PAR regime daily, supplemented with UV-B radiation for 9 h. Measurements were made at 3.5 and 7 days. One-way ANOVA from Statistica 4.0 software was used for statistical analysis. Bars indicate standard deviation and letters indicate statistical difference (p ≤ 0.05).
